Summary
Daniel Chalfon is a seasoned venture capitalist, currently a General Partner at Astella, a Brazilian VC firm, where he focuses on investing in and supporting consumer and long-tail B2B companies. He is instrumental in deal origination and investment processes. com+2
With over 25 years of experience in the Brazilian communication and media market, Daniel has a strong background in advertising, having co-founded MPM agency (which later merged with Loducca) and held leadership roles at LDC, DM9DDB, and McCann Erickson. clay+1
Beyond his investment career, Daniel is an active entrepreneur and musician. He co-founded AudioArena, a unique recording studio, and is a composer and performer (synthesizers and bass) in the electro-rock band Jules and the electronic duo XCOPY. milocostudios+2
Daniel is committed to fostering the entrepreneurial ecosystem in Brazil. He hosts the 'Astella Playbook' podcast, a leading tech podcast in the country, and has been an active volunteer at Endeavor Brasil since 2008, also serving on boards for various companies and non-profit organizations like IVC and gm.org.br. clay+1
